This auction is for a custom made set of Leather Saddlebags that were designed for a Big Twin Harley Davidson, but that would also fit most big cruiser type motorcycles.

Made of thick but soft pecan colored leather they are approx 17" by 17" on both sides. Adjustable via rawhide lacing.

They have the pictured inner black color heavy semi rigid nylon type panels to keep the bags away from rear wheel spokes.
The bags have heavy nylon zippers and a good sized cover flap over the entire length of each zipper.

In the last photo I stuffed crumpled paper into one side so you could get an idea of what it would look like when somewhat full. Filled up each side is approx 12.5" by 12.5" by 9.5".

2013 Kia Sorento facelift The 2013 Kia Sorento facelift has been revealed ahead of a debut at the New York Motor Show in April. Ahead of a public debut at the New York Motor Show in April, Kia has revealed a facelift for the Sorento crossover / SUV, although it’s not exactly comprehensive. Top of the noticeable stuff on the new Sorento is the adoption of the latest Kia signature grill, with a reddeigned front bumper and tweaks to the air intakes and fogs.

BICYCLE RIDERS need to take more responsibility for their own safety in the wake of a spate of cyclists' deaths, one of London's top police officers has said. Chief Superintendent Glyn Jones's comments came after launching a new initiative that will see 2,500 officers being asked to reinforce traffic rules in the capital's most notorious black spots from tomorrow. The initiative was in response to the worrying statistic that six cyclists have been killed on London's roads in two weeks.
